Job Summary:
The Senior Practitioner Adults Safeguarding plays a key leadership role within Hackney Adult Services providing professional supervision safeguarding oversight and high-quality social work practice for adults with complex needs.
The post holder supports staff to deliver strengths-based person-centred services ensures compliance with statutory safeguarding duties and works collaboratively with multi-disciplinary partners to improve outcomes for vulnerable adults.
Key Duties/Accountabilities (Sample):
Provide professional supervision guidance and performance management for social work staff.
Lead and oversee Adult Safeguarding practice in line with local and national legislation.
Allocate and manage complex caseloads including high-risk safeguarding cases.
Chair and/or lead Safeguarding Adults Meetings Best Interest Meetings and case conferences.
Ensure compliance with the Care Act Mental Capacity Act DoLS and safeguarding procedures.
Promote and embed strengths-based and personalisation approaches across the team.
Support staff with complex assessments and risk management decision-making.
Work in partnership with health housing mental health and third-sector organisations.
Contribute to quality assurance audits and service improvement initiatives.
Deputise for the Team Manager when required and support operational service delivery.
Manage financial awareness of care packages and contribute to budget control.
Ensure accurate case recording and performance reporting.
